“Thanks to the leadership of The Blocker Foundation, Virginia’s Community Colleges are thrilled to launch a transformational initiative to better support parenting students and their children. The College Attainment for Parent Students (CAPS) program will be the first effort in Hampton Roads that simultaneously removes barriers for parenting students and improves early childhood access and quality for their young children. By providing coaching, mentoring, emergency funds, tuition assistance, childcare funding, and additional children’s learning resources, the CAPS program will truly represent a two-generation anti-poverty solution that improves the employment and income opportunities for parents and the early childhood experience for their children. This pilot program will put Hampton Roads at the forefront of an effort to create a national blueprint for how policymakers, states and colleges can better serve parent students.
